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,745 in Squamish, BC versus $2,462 in Calgary.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$4,106 in Squamish, BC versus $3,628 in Calgary.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$5,467 in Squamish, BC versus $4,795 in Calgary.

Living in Squamish, BC is roughly 11% more expensive than in Calgary, driven mainly by Getting Around.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Squamish, BC 105% above, Calgary 84% above.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,676 in Squamish, BC and $1,380 in Calgary.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Squamish, BC pays 4%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$74.0 in Squamish, BC vs $70.0 in Calgary. Groceries flip the comparison at $365 vs $396, with Squamish, BC cheaper for home cooking.
